The Importance of Trust
Trust is a fundamental component of any relationship, whether personal or professional. It's the glue that holds relationships together, fostering a sense of security, loyalty, and commitment. When trust is present, individuals feel valued, respected, and supported, which can lead to stronger, more meaningful connections.
Why Trust Matters
1. Builds Strong Relationships: Trust is the foundation of strong, healthy relationships. When both parties trust each other, they can communicate openly, share their thoughts and feelings, and work together to overcome challenges.
2. Fosters Loyalty and Commitment: When individuals trust each other, they're more likely to be loyal and committed to the relationship. Trust creates a sense of security, which encourages individuals to invest in the relationship and work through challenges.
3. Promotes Effective Communication
: Trust facilitates open and honest communication. When individuals trust each other, they're more likely to share their thoughts, feelings, and concerns, which can help prevent misunderstandings and conflicts.
4. Encourages Collaboration and Teamwork: Trust is essential for effective teamwork and collaboration. When team members trust each other, they're more likely to share ideas, work together, and support each other to achieve common goals.
5. Supports Personal Growth: Trust can support personal growth by creating a safe and supportive environment. When individuals feel trusted, they're more likely to take risks, try new things, and develop their skills and abilities.
The Consequences of Broken Trust
1. Damages Relationships: Broken trust can damage relationships, making it challenging to repair them.
2. Creates Conflict: Lack of trust can lead to conflict, misunderstandings, and miscommunication.
3. Erodes Confidence: Broken trust can erode confidence, making it difficult for individuals to trust others in the future.
Building and Maintaining Trust
1. Be Honest and Transparent: Honesty and transparency are essential for building trust.
2. Keep Promises: Keeping promises and following through on commitments helps build trust.
3. Communicate Openly: Open and honest communication can help build trust and prevent misunderstandings.
4. Be Reliable: Being reliable and dependable can help build trust.
5. Show Empathy and Understanding: Showing empathy and understanding can help build trust and strengthen relationships.
In conclusion, trust is a vital component of any relationship. By understanding its importance and taking steps to build and maintain trust, we can foster stronger, more meaningful connections with others.
